• Aneel Chawla

    Aneel Chawla 2 videos

  • 0 followers

Total 2 videos
0 views
10 minutes ago

Broken heart

0 views
2 hours ago

People

Latest Videos Febspot Explore Monetization Terms of Service About Us Copyright Cookie Privacy Contact
© 2026 Febspot. All Rights Reserved.